Abstract

PT Karya Megah Indowood is a company engaged in veneer manufacturing. The company does not utilize renewable technology to create a system that can assist the company in managing its operations. By not using adequate technology, the company takes more time for its administrative activities, thus affecting the company's productivity. The lack of technology and integrated management systems also leads to a lack of efficiency in inventory management, distribution, and internal communication, hindering the company's growth. It is expected that an integrated technology system can assist the company in increasing its productivity. The problems faced by the company can be improved through the implementation of technology in the Supply Chain Management process and Enterprise Resource Planning using the odoo system. The use of Purchase, Inventory, Sales, and CRM modules is an application in odoo that is applied to purchase goods, check inventory, and strengthen the company's relationship with customers at PT Karya Megah Indowood so that the company's productivity will increase.
